I Killed Zoe Spanos by Kit Frick

3.0

3.5/5 stars. This book reminds me a lot of Sadie by Courtney Summers, which I think it will be compared to a lot on account of the podcast element, as well as the mystery and dual timelines. I did find myself getting a bit confused at times with the timelines as Frick alludes to Anna having visited Herron Mills previously and this really muddied the waters for me in terms of what was happening when. Although I didn't see the ending coming, I was a little unsatisfied by it, but overall, an interesting read.
